use triton_vm::prelude::*;
use crate::prelude::*;
/// A u32 `pow` that behaves like Rustc's `pow` method on `u32`, crashing in case of overflow.
#[derive(Debug, Copy, Clone, Eq, PartialEq, Hash)]
pub struct SafePow;
impl BasicSnippet for SafePow {
fn inputs(&self) -> Vec<(DataType, String)> {
vec![
(DataType::U32, "base".to_owned()),
(DataType::U32, "exponent".to_owned()),
]
}
fn outputs(&self) -> Vec<(DataType, String)> {
vec![(DataType::U32, "result".to_owned())]
}
fn entrypoint(&self) -> String {
"tasmlib_arithmetic_u32_safe_pow".to_string()
}
fn code(&self, _: &mut Library) -> Vec<LabelledInstruction> {
// This algorithm is implemented below. `bpow2` has type
// `u64` because it would otherwise erroneously overflow
// in the last iteration of the loop when e.g. calculating
// 2.pow(31).
// fn safe_pow(base: u32, exponent: u64) -> Self {
// let mut bpow2: u64 = base as u64;
// let mut acc = 1u32;
// let mut i = exponent;
// while i != 0 {
// if i & 1 == 1 {
// acc *= bpow2;
// }
// bpow2 *= bpow2;
// i >>= 1;
// }
// acc
// }
let entrypoint = self.entrypoint();
let while_acc_label = format!("{entrypoint}_while_acc");
let mul_acc_with_bpow2_label = format!("{entrypoint}_mul_acc_with_bpow2");
triton_asm!(
{entrypoint}:
// _ base exponent
push 0
swap 2
swap 1
// _ 0 base exponent
push 1
// _ [base_u64] exponent acc
// rename: `exponent` -> `i`, `base_u64` -> `bpow2_u64`
// _ [bpow2_u64] i acc
call {while_acc_label}
// _ [bpow2_u64] 0 acc
swap 3
pop 3
return
// INVARIANT: _ [bpow2_u64] i acc
{while_acc_label}:
// check condition
dup 1 push 0 eq
skiz
return
// _ [bpow2_u64] i acc
// Verify that `bpow2_u64` does not exceed `u32::MAX`
dup 3 push 0 eq assert error_id 120
// _ 0 bpow2 i acc
dup 1
push 1
and
// _ 0 bpow2 i acc (i & 1)
skiz
call {mul_acc_with_bpow2_label}
// _ 0 bpow2 i acc
swap 2
// _ 0 acc i bpow2
dup 0 mul split
// _ 0 acc i bpow2_next_hi bpow2_next_lo
// GOAL: // _ [bpow_u64] i acc
swap 3
// _ 0 bpow2_next_lo i bpow2_next_hi acc
swap 1
// _ 0 bpow2_next_lo i acc bpow2_next_hi
swap 4 pop 1
// _ bpow2_next_hi bpow2_next_lo i acc
// _ [bpow2_next_u64] i acc
push 2
// _ [bpow2_next_u64] i acc 2
dup 2
// _ [bpow2_next_u64] i acc 2 i
div_mod
// _ [bpow2_u64] i acc (i >> 2) (i % 2)
pop 1 swap 2 pop 1
// _ [bpow2_u64] (i >> 2) acc
recurse
{mul_acc_with_bpow2_label}:
// _ 0 bpow2 i acc
dup 2
mul
// _ 0 bpow2 i (acc * bpow2)
split swap 1 push 0 eq assert error_id 121
// _ 0 bpow2 i new_acc
return
)
}
}
